Morgan Chaney (PhD candidate and T32 NIH Fellow, Department of Biological Sciences) will present "Sexual signals under genetically constrained polymorphisms - how does the female perceive quality?" at our Seminar in Hearing Research at Purdue (SHRP) on April 8th at 1030-1120 on Zoom.
